Similar Dave. Walking in had strong winds out of west. Stop before entering woods and it felt S or SW. Get in tree and it was W/SW and sometimes S. Times I could hear a lot were few. Seemed like the wind was steadily blowing more than the forecast of 5mph with gust to 10-15. Felt more like a steady 7-10mph wind with occasional pauses and occasional stronger gust. I feel this was part of my reason for seeing nothing. I have seen them move in wind before but we really haven't had a lot of wind lately. If it is windy for days at a time they have to move. If it is windy a day here or there it seems like they sit idle. Could be wrong. Just seems that way.
